What is Battletech TCG?

In the Battletech Universe you play the role of a commander. You are a strategist who fights other armies for money, some for glory, and some battle under the banner of kerensky. Your deck of cards represents the options you have at your disposal. It will contain battle mechs, vehicles, and a array of missions and commands which may assist you in your battle.


Trading card games combine the idea of card collecting with strategy game. Each boost pack contains random commons, uncommons, and rares. You can start a collection and trade with others for cards you want, or you can just pay a little extra for singles. Battletech releases expansions a few times a year. Each new expansion brings new, old, and revised ways to destroy your foes.

When was the original Battletech TCG created? In 1996 Wizards of the Coast developed a game based around the Battletech universe. It was a collectible card game which featured characters, technology, mechs, and story quotes from the original board game with artwork done but a variety of artists. with new artwork done by various artists.

Around 2001 the game ended its production because of the lack of players. Many people had discussed that the main cause for their lost of interest in the game was the overly simplistic design of victory. A project in 2007 started in the development by a independent design team which tried to work out the kinks of the old card game and kick it into high gear. A number of changes have been made to Battletech TCG to make it to players expectations.
